Stormwater Management
Kapolei properties tied to the city's separate storm sewer system are regulated by ROH Chapter 43, Article 11, which bars non-stormwater discharges and enforces MS4 water quality standards.

Heavy RestrictionsErosion Control
ROH Sec. 18A-1.6 requires approved erosion and sediment control plans for Kapolei land-disturbing activities that need building, grading, stockpiling, or trenching permits.

Heavy RestrictionsCoastal Development
Kapolei projects near the leeward coast may fall within a Special Management Area regulated by ROH Chapter 25, implementing Hawaii's HRS Chapter 205A coastal zone management program.

Heavy RestrictionsFlood Zones
Kapolei parcels within FEMA special flood hazard areas are regulated by ROH Chapter 21A, which sets elevation, flood-proofing, and variance standards for floodplain development.

Heavy RestrictionsGrading & Drainage
Kapolei grading, grubbing, stockpiling, and drainage work is regulated by ROH Chapter 18A, which requires permits, bonds, and inspections for qualifying land-disturbing activity.
